HR and Compliance Manager

Global Care Optometry operates over 60 offices of optometry in 9 states, with additional locations opening this year.  Our dynamic and fast-growing company is looking for an HR and Compliance Manager to lead our human capital management and oversee our HIPAA compliance program.  We work with outside consultants in the design and implementation of our HIPAA program. Previous HIPAA knowledge is preferred but not required.

 

This position will be instrumental in maintaining a culture based on teamwork and open communication.

Responsibilities include but not limited to:

HR and Compliance Manager will play an integral part of the entire company’s success by:

  • Nurturing a positive working environment.
  • Partner with department supervisors to manage the recruitment and selection process by posting job ads for all departments, sourcing candidates, conducting phone screens, and scheduling in-person interviews.
  • Responsible for onboarding newly hired employees, including but not limited to offer letters, contracts, employee handbook overview, employment verification, employment documents, and benefits enrollment. 
  • Responsible for off-boarding documentation, exit interviews, and collections of company property.
  • Responsible for reviewing, editing, and drafting current HR policies, company handbook, company policies, job descriptions and postings, standard operating procedures, and other human capital-related documents.
  • Developing and overseeing employee training programs and employee career development.
  • Assist in planning and scheduling lunch and learns, quarterly company outings, leadership and development seminars, and team-building events and exercises.
  • Assist in celebrating and planning employee birthdays, anniversaries, employee of the quarter, and office festivities.
  • Assist with organizing and scheduling philanthropic efforts.
  • Stay up to date on regulatory changes, new regulations, and internal workplace policy changes.
  • Communicating internal procedures, policy changes, reminders, and company memos.
  • Assist department supervisors in the creation and measurement of KPIs.
    • Review KPIs to ensure they are specific, measurable, attainable, realistic and time bound.
    • Ensure all KPIs are calculated, and bonuses are processed by the assigned deadlines.
  • Oversee and conduct employee performance evaluations with department supervisors. This includes 90-day performance and annual reviews. Ensure all reviews are completed by the assigned deadlines.
  • Assisting department supervisors with drafting and delivering verbal warnings, written warnings, performance improvement plans, and termination notices.
  • Provide support and guidance to management on sensitive issues including but not limited to providing reasonable accommodations and conflict resolution.
  • Conducts confidential HR investigations.
  • Oversee organization’s HIPAA compliance program ongoing development, implementation, and maintenance. Work with current outside vendor to ensure program is updated as needed and properly documented.
  • Create and maintain complete and confidential files of each employee. Process, verify and maintain documentation relating to personnel activities such as staffing, recruitment, training, grievances, performance evaluations and classifications.
  • Assist with company benefit administration to include enrollment forms, plan questions, claims resolution, and open enrollment.
  • Act as a resource to management and staff on benefit related questions and issues.
  • Responsible for processing bi-weekly payroll and managing employee time-punch inconsistencies and errors.
